2. Instrument Panel Buttons
In 2017 Honda CRV models not equipped with a touchscreen infotainment system, physical buttons located on the instrument panel serve as the primary interface for adjusting the clock. These buttons, often in conjunction with the vehicle’s information display screen, provide a direct means of accessing and modifying various settings, including the time. The functionality of these buttons is crucial to the process; without them, setting the clock is impossible in these models. For instance, the “SEL/RESET” button and the “INFO” button are often utilized to navigate the menu and make adjustments.
The process typically involves pressing the “INFO” button to cycle through the available display options until the clock setting menu is reached. Once this menu is displayed, the “SEL/RESET” button is used to select the option for adjusting the hours or minutes. Subsequent presses of this button increment the selected value. Frequently Asked Questions
This section addresses common inquiries regarding the procedure for setting the clock in a 2017 Honda CRV, providing clarity and guidance for accurate timekeeping.
Question 1: What is the procedure for setting the clock in a 2017 Honda CRV equipped with a touchscreen?
The procedure typically involves accessing the “Settings” menu on the touchscreen, navigating to “System” or “Clock” options, and then using the on-screen controls to adjust the hours and minutes. Confirmation of the new time is usually required to save the changes.
Question 2: How is the clock set in a 2017 Honda CRV that does not have a touchscreen?
Models without a touchscreen generally use physical buttons located on the instrument panel. The “INFO” or “SEL/RESET” buttons are used to cycle through display options until the clock settings are accessed. Subsequent button presses increment or decrement the hour and minute values.
Question 3: Does the 2017 Honda CRV automatically adjust for Daylight Saving Time?
Some models may have an automatic Daylight Saving Time adjustment feature, but its functionality is not guaranteed. It is advisable to verify the clock’s accuracy during Daylight Saving Time transitions and manually adjust if necessary.
Question 4: Where can the option to switch between 12-hour and 24-hour clock formats be found?
The option to switch between 12-hour and 24-hour clock formats is typically located within the clock settings menu. The precise location varies depending on whether the vehicle is equipped with a touchscreen or relies on physical buttons for control.
Question 5: What steps should be taken if the clock cannot be set or continuously resets?
In situations where the clock cannot be set or resets frequently, the vehicle’s electrical system should be inspected. A faulty battery, a blown fuse, or a malfunctioning infotainment system can cause these issues. Professional diagnosis is recommended.
